#163123 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#163123 is composed of 8.6% red, 19.2% green and 13.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 28.6% yellow and 80.8% black. It has a hue angle of 148.9 degrees, a saturation of 38% and a lightness of 13.9%. #163123 color hex could be obtained by blending #2c6246 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003333.

Shades and Tints of #163123

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040806 is the darkest color, while #fafdf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#163123

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#212623 is the less saturated color, while #004722 is the most saturated one.
